Sets? I wouldn't call magnets a set, but BrickLink will oblige.
The Design ID is 90754, although BrickLink calls them 74188c01.
Available in Bright Red, Bright Blue, Bright Yellow, Brick Yellow and Dark Stone Grey for which the Element IDs are 4611441-5 respectively. Black is 4620392. There's also one in Medium Azure.
